Output 2017495892138e073fed2c007e101dab6220759d16eea306f8b88f62555060e9:0

value
489232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f25efaee193d01de20cf3bfac349d2975d068be OP_EQUAL
address
3DHKBmG6pXfdNtECxedhRPLNnAjWJrjpib
transaction
2017495892138e073fed2c007e101dab6220759d16eea306f8b88f62555060e9
spent
true